Record-Breaking Jeopardy! Victories

Jeopardy! has seen several record-breaking finales, with multi-day champions and tournament formats pushing total winnings to new highs. Strategic wagering and deep knowledge are essential to reaching the top of the leaderboard.

James Holzhauer's Dominance

James Holzhauer set multiple records in 2019 with aggressive Daily Double hunting and precise wagering. His total combined earnings across regular and tournament play surpassed previous high-rollers on the show.

Tournament Of Champions Milestones

Special tournaments have allowed past champions to compete for even larger cumulative prizes, with some winners adding hundreds of thousands more to their original victories.

FAQ

Reader questions

How are game show winnings taxed in the United States?

All cash prizes are treated as taxable income by the IRS, reported on Form 1099-MISC, with the show or production company responsible for withholding based on federal tax rules.

Can a contestant refuse the prize and walk away with nothing?

While extremely rare, rules allow contestants to decline prizes in some formats, but this typically results in no payout and may affect eligibility for future appearances.

Do contestants receive their winnings immediately after taping?

Payout timing varies by show, with many issuing checks or electronic transfers weeks later after audits, tax withholdings, and production approvals are completed.

Are syndicated game show winnings protected from lawsuits or creditors?

In most U.S. states, lottery and game show winnings may be subject to creditor claims, so winners often consult legal and financial professionals before claiming large prizes.
